In Joshua chapter 4, Joshua calls the leaders of each of the twelve tribes to pick up a stone, carry it with them, and lay it down on the other side of the Jordan. These stones would serve as a “remembrance” for generations to come as a sign of what God had done for them.

So tonight as I gathered stones at Teaberry Acres and laid them one by one around the fire, I remembered. I remembered that God paved the way for this very acreage to land THE121 on. I remembered all that HE HAS DONE.
So chances are when you come to Teaberry Acres, I’ll ask you to pick up a stone and lay it down around the pit. I’ll ask you to remember and tell me the story of what God has done for you. And if you don’t have your own story, I’ll tell you one of mine.
